The Impact of Sustainability on Retail Careers: A Comprehensive Guide

Published by EditorsDesk
Category : general


Sustainability is a growing concern for consumers and businesses alike, and the retail industry is no exception. Retail businesses that embrace sustainability are better able to meet customer demands, reduce their environmental impact, and create a more sustainable future. In this comprehensive guide, we will explore the impact of sustainability on retail careers and the skills and strategies needed to succeed in this dynamic and evolving field.

Impact of Sustainability on Retail Careers:

Meeting Customer Demands:
Consumers are increasingly demanding sustainable products and services, and retail businesses that fail to meet these demands risk losing customers to competitors. Retail professionals must understand the importance of sustainability and develop strategies for meeting customer demands for sustainable products and services.

Reducing Environmental Impact:
Retail businesses have a significant environmental impact, from the sourcing of raw materials to the disposal of products and packaging. Retail professionals must develop strategies for reducing this impact, such as sourcing sustainable materials, using renewable energy, and reducing waste.

Creating a More Sustainable Future:
Sustainability is critical to creating a more sustainable future, and retail professionals have an important role to play in this process. By embracing sustainability and developing strategies for reducing their environmental impact, retail businesses can contribute to the creation of a more sustainable future.

Skills and Strategies for Sustainability in Retail Careers:

Sustainability Knowledge:
Retail professionals must have a good understanding of sustainability and the environmental impact of retail businesses. They must be able to identify areas of environmental impact and develop strategies for reducing this impact.

Innovation:
Sustainability requires innovation, and retail professionals must be able to think creatively and develop new strategies for reducing environmental impact and meeting customer demands for sustainable products and services.

Collaboration:
Sustainability requires collaboration, and retail professionals must be able to work with cross-functional teams and stakeholders to develop and implement sustainability strategies.

Communication:
Retail professionals must have excellent communication skills, including the ability to communicate sustainability strategies to internal and external stakeholders.

Industry Knowledge:
Retail professionals must have a good understanding of the retail industry, including market trends, consumer behavior, and competitive landscape, and be able to apply this knowledge to develop effective sustainability strategies.

In conclusion, sustainability is a critical aspect of the retail industry that requires a diverse range of skills and strategies. By developing the necessary skills, such as sustainability knowledge, innovation, collaboration, communication, and industry knowledge, professionals can pursue a successful and rewarding career in sustainability in the retail industry. With the right education, training, and experience, professionals can make a meaningful impact on the success of retail businesses and contribute to the creation of a more sustainable future.

The FiveMinute Rule A Simple Trick to Boost Your Productivity

Procrastination and task avoidance are common challenges in the workplace. Sometimes, the hardest part of any task is simply getting started. Enter the Five-Minute Rule – a simple, yet effective technique to kickstart productivity and overcome the inertia of procrastination. Let’s dive into what this rule is and how you can apply it to your work life.

1. What is the Five-Minute Rule?

  • The Five-Minute Rule states that you commit to working on a task for just five minutes. After five minutes, you give yourself the choice to continue or stop.

2. Why It Works

  • Overcomes Initial Resistance: Starting is often the hardest part. Committing to just five minutes feels manageable and less daunting.
  • Builds Momentum: Once you begin, you’re likely to continue beyond the initial five minutes, as getting started is often the biggest hurdle.
  • Reduces Overwhelm: It breaks down larger, more intimidating tasks into smaller, more manageable pieces.

3. Applying the Rule in Your Workday

  • Start with the Most Challenging Task: Tackle your most daunting task first with the Five-Minute Rule. It’s a great way to make progress on projects you’ve been avoiding.
  • Use it for Small Tasks Too: Even for less intimidating tasks, committing to a short, focused burst can increase efficiency.

4. Combining with Other Techniques

  • Pair the Five-Minute Rule with other productivity methods. For example, use it alongside the Pomodoro Technique for longer tasks, breaking work into intervals with short breaks.

5. Making it a Habit

  • Consistency is key. Make the Five-Minute Rule a part of your daily routine to see long-term changes in your productivity patterns.

6. Adapting the Rule for Different Tasks

  • The rule is flexible. For some tasks, you might extend it to ten or fifteen minutes. The core principle remains the same – just get started.

7. Tracking Your Progress

  • Keep a log of tasks where you applied the Five-Minute Rule. This will help you see the cumulative effect of those minutes in tackling big projects.

8. Conclusion

The Five-Minute Rule is a powerful tool in your productivity arsenal. It’s simple, requires no special tools, and can be remarkably effective. By committing to just five minutes, you’ll often find that you’ve kickstarted a productive work session, turning dread into progress, one small step at a time.
